  • UKFI backs Lloyds ahead of crucial annual meeting

    June 2, 2009

    UK FINANCIAL Investments (UKFI) – the body which manages the government’s 43 per cent stake in Lloyds Banking Group – has confirmed it will not oppose resolutions at Lloyds’ annual meeting on Friday. The bank is likely to face significant shareholder ire over the takeover of HBOS, with some expected to vote against the re-election [...]

  • Fears over Barclays sell-off drag the FTSE 100 down

    June 2, 2009

    THE FTSE 100 ended down 0.7 per cent yesterday, hurt by banks after a major shareholder sold its holding in Barclays, although improving US pending home sales lent some support. The index closed 29.17 points lower at 4,477.02, giving up some of the previous session’s 2 per cent rise. Barclays topped the FTSE 100 losers’ [...]

  • First Property plots UK return

    June 2, 2009

    AIM-listed First Property Group yesterday announced its financial results for the fiscal year ended 31 March 2009, reporting pre-tax  profit of £3.22m in comparison with profit of £4.66m in the previous year. The central and east European property fund said it was sizing up a return to the UK market as confidence returns to the [...]

  • Housing data gives US markets a boost

    June 2, 2009

    US stocks rose for the fourth straight day yesterday as an upbeat report on sales of previously owned US homes bolstered hopes for an economic recovery. But a sell-off in financials on worries about the dilutive impact of recent stock offerings limited a broad advance. An index of pending sales of previously owned US homes [...]

  • Cheap booze risks overstated

    June 2, 2009

    The impact of cheap alcohol on heavy and hazardous drinkers has been overestimated according to a report out today by the Centre for Economics and Business Research (CEBR). The report claims that moderate drinkers are seriously overpaying for the government’s policy on alcohol where the benefits of increased prices such as reductions in health, crime, [...]

  • Acer to launch a Google laptop

    June 2, 2009

    Acer, the world’s third-biggest PC brand, said yesterday it plans to sell netbook PCs that run on Google’s Android operating software in the third quarter of this year. The announcement is a major coup for Google, which is pushing into software and services, to complement its online advertising revenues. But the news will come as [...]

  • Omega in Names offer

    June 2, 2009

    OMEGA Insurance plans to boost its exposure to Lloyds of London, spending up to £125m buying out Names who are members of the insurance market’s successful Syndicate 958. Omega already has a 16 per cent stake in Syndicate 958, which has turned a profit every year since 1980. It is offering to pay private investors [...]
